Poem – Weathering the Storm

I look for courage out there … and I find very few.
Many wonder if we are going to make it through.

Remember that our ancestors weathered terrible times.
And they were also the victim of very hateful crimes.

Each generation must learn to weather a storm.
The problem now is that it seems to have become the norm.

But storms will come and eventually go.
The problem is that it is the timing we do not know.

We buckle down in order to brace for a long haul.
We are horrified at those that hold such hateful gall.

It is incredulous that there are so many that cannot see.
That what someone presents is not how they will let it be.

So here we are … and the storm has come.
There is nowhere to go and nowhere to run.

Prepare to plant that garden so you have what you will need.
Learn the ways of plants so you do not waste seed.

Make enough so that you have more to share.
Many are not prepared and even more do not really care.
~Suzanne Wagner~
